BIG BROTHERS BIG SISTERS POLICY UNDER FIRERecently, Big Brothers Big Sisters of America (BBBSA) decided to require its local chapters to uphold the organization's national non-discrimination policy around sexual orientation. Although the policy is not new, until July of this year it was left to the discretion of the 500 local chapters whether to adopt the policy. Already, national and regional news stories, including ones in The Indianapolis Star and Fox News, as well as discussions on talk radio have addressed this issue. What many outlets may fail to cover is that each parent always has the final decision whether or not a mentor, regardless of sexual orientation, is right for his or her child, GLAAD said. Some anti-gay groups opposed to BBBSA's policy are campaigning that gays and lesbians are dangerous to children by characterizing gay men and lesbians as sexual predators and pedophiles. But what these groups ignore is overwhelming evidence that gays and lesbians are no more likely to be pedophiles than heterosexuals, GLAAD said.
